Manual handling describes any task that calls for an individual to raise, reduced, press, pull, lug, or move a things. Common Injuries from Improper Handbook Handling
When workers engage in inappropriate hand-operated handling methods, they might suffer from:
Back Strains: One of the most typical injury related to hand-operated handling. Neck Discomfort: Frequently brought on by lifting hefty lots incorrectly. Shoulder Injuries: Arising from repetitive overhanging lifting. Knee Injuries: Particularly prevalent in building or warehouse settings.
Recognizing these potential hazards stresses the requirement of appropriate training and awareness.

Manual Handling Strategies for Safe Practice
The Fundamentals of Appropriate Lifting Techniques
Assess the Lots: Before lifting any things, review its weight and size. Position Your Feet: Stand shoulder-width apart for far better balance. Bend Your Knees: Keep your back right while bending your knees for leverage. Grip Firmly: Guarantee you have a great hold on the item before lifting it. Lift with Your Legs: Utilize your leg muscle mass as opposed to your when lifting. Keep the Tons Close: Hold items close to your body while moving them. Avoid Twisting: Move your feet rather than turning your torso while bring loads.
